The Journey Home to Pemberley Giveaways for August-September 2019

Joana Starnes is no stranger to the Jane Austen fan fiction publishing world. Having published eight Austen-themed novels and contributed short stories in The Quill Collective anthology series, she recently launched a new Pride and Prejudice variation. If you are familiar with the original novel, you will know that the Gardiners together with Elizabeth initially plan to tour the Lake District which located in the northern part of England. However due to Mr Gardiner's business dealings, their vacation is postpone and limited to Derbyshire county. What if they managed to visit the Lakes and encounter Mr Darcy? Thus that is the premise of The Journey Home to Pemberley . Just like Elizabeth, Joana is also going on tour albeit a virtual one. The Mysterious Death of Miss Jane Austen Giveaways for August 2013

Back in October 2011, Lindsay Jayne Ashford's debut novel published in the UK as The Mysterious Death of Miss Austen generated a buzz in the Internet with a new theory speculating on how one of the greatest English novelist could have died. Her mysterious final illness has become a subject of enduring literary fascination among Janeite community so much so that scientists and historians have come up with a number of possibilities including Addison's disease, Hodgkin's lymphoma, bovine tuberculosis and Brill-Zinsser disease. As the actual cause of death could not be scientifically determined, could it be that she died from arsenic poisoning? If so, who is responsible and what other secrets are hidden from us? That is the premise of crime writer Ms Ashford in penning her biographical fiction of Jane Austen's death.
